Earned Reach

The exposure a brand gains through word-of-mouth or viral sharing, as opposed to paid advertising or owned media.

Fandom

The community of fans that passionately support a particular subject, such as a book series, television show, movie, or celebrity.

Brand Engagement

A measure of the attachment and interaction between a customer and a brand, including how actively involved the customer is with the brand.

Brand Persona

A representation of a brand's identity, character, and values as perceived by its audience.
